Environmental Studies: Austin College invites applications for a
tenure-track position at the rank of Assistant Professor beginning August
2013.
Ph.D. in one of the traditional social sciences or a related interdisciplinary field required. Candidates are expected to teach Fundamentals of Environmental Studies and offer courses in social aspects of environmental problems on topics such as sustainable development, environmental justice, resource management, systems analysis, or environmental policy. The successful candidate will demonstrate a strong commitment to teaching and an active research agenda focused upon environmental concerns.
